MECHANICAL CONSULTANT - TECHNICAL ADVISORY GROUP
DayOne is a leading developer and operator of high-performance Data Centres in Asia
Pacific. Dual listed in NASDAQ and Hong Kong, DayOne is the largest carrier-neutral Data
Centre service provider in Asia and one of the fastest growing in the world with a presence
in Mainland China, Hong Kong, Singapore, Malaysia, Indonesia, and Japan.
DayOne is on an exciting trajectory, expanding markets internationally and looking for
talented individuals who are passionate about growing with us. In this role, you'll have the
opportunity to be at the forefront of our expansion efforts.
POSITION OVERVIEW
Reporting to the Head of the Technical Advisory Group, the Mechanical Specialist, is a
critical role within our global Data Centre team. This position provides specialised expertise
and support in mechanical systems across our Data Centre facilities worldwide. The
Mechanical Specialist will be responsible for various aspects of HV systems, including design,
installation & maintenance, troubleshooting & repair, system monitoring & optimization,
and emergency response.
ROLE AND RESPONSIBILITIES
- Mechanical Systems Management: Oversee the design, installation, and
maintenance of mechanical systems within our Data Centre facilities.
- Troubleshooting and Repair: Support local site DCO teams and lead troubleshooting
efforts for complex Mechanical systems, identifying and resolving issues promptly to
minimize downtime.
- System Monitoring and Optimization: Implement monitoring tools and processes to
continuously optimize the performance of mechanical systems. Identify areas for
improvement and drive initiatives to enhance efficiency and reliability.
- Emergency Response: Develop and implement emergency response procedures for
mechanical incidents. Coordinate with cross-functional teams to mitigate risks and
minimize impact during emergencies.
- Collaboration and Knowledge Sharing: Collaborate with internal teams and external
partners to leverage expertise and best practices in mechanical systems. Share
knowledge and provide training to enhance the overall competency of the
organization.
- Global Remit: Support mechanical operations across various regions, with a
particular focus on APAC and wider territories. Adapt strategies and solutions to
meet regional requirements and regulations.
CANDIDATE REQUIREMENTS
- Bachelor's degree in Mechanical Engineering or related field. Advanced degree
preferred.
- Extensive experience (5+ years) in mechanical systems, preferably in Data Centre or
critical infrastructure environments.
- Strong knowledge of mechanical design principles, installation practices, and
maintenance procedures.
- Proven track record in troubleshooting complex mechanical systems and
implementing effective solutions.
- Experience in system monitoring and optimization, with proficiency in relevant tools
and technologies.
- Ability to work collaboratively in a cross-functional team environment, with excellent
communication and interpersonal skills.
- Experience working in APAC and other global regions is a plus, demonstrating an
understanding of regional regulatory requirements and operational challenges.
- Willingness to travel occasionally to support global projects and initiatives.
